Exploring the Richness of American Wine

From the sun-drenched vineyards of California to the historic estates of Virginia, American wine embodies a pioneering spirit combined with a deep respect for tradition. The United States offers a vast tapestry of winemaking, with each region bringing its unique terroir and innovative techniques to the forefront. In the heart of Napa Valley, world-renowned Cabernet Sauvignon and Chardonnay varietals tell a story of meticulous craftsmanship and bold flavors. Meanwhile, the cooler climates of Oregon's Willamette Valley produce Pinot Noir and Pinot Gris that rival the best in the world, with their nuanced expressions and delicate balance.

Beyond these giants, emerging wine regions across the country, from the Finger Lakes in New York to the Texas Hill Country, are gaining acclaim for their distinctive wines and adventurous approaches. Winemakers in these areas are experimenting with a variety of grapes and methods, contributing to the dynamic and ever-evolving American wine landscape. The result is a compelling collection of wines that reflect the diverse climates, cultures, and spirit of innovation inherent to the United States.
